re: Assistance for Those Most in NeedAssistance for Those Most in Need


Lane Dilg, Interim City Manager

City of Santa Monica


May 21, 2020


Dear Lane,


Thank you for your thoughtful leadership during these difficult times. Santa Monica Forward is committed to meeting the needs of all Santa Monica residents with the value of equity in the forefront. We write regarding urgent efforts to support laid-off and furloughed residents who have little access to aid.


We appreciate that you have recognized that some members of the Santa Monica community are not eligible for federal stimulus payments or state unemployment benefits even as they, too, may have lost work or have faced small business disruption. As recently announced in SaMoNews, the State of California, in partnership with a number of philanthropies, has made emergency funding available to these individuals and families through Los Angeles County-area nonprofit organizations.


As you ramp up the Santa Monica Cares initiative, we stand ready to help amplify City outreach communications, including what we hope will be daily video, flyers, text messages, social media, and direct communications with people who may be eligible about how to access these opportunities. We would welcome the identification of a local channel to apply for these funds that we can share with community members.


We also hope that staff is in contact with operators of philanthropic funds that are going to communities that may not be reached through the organizations listed above, including Black immigrants, LGBTQ immigrants, car wash workers, Pilipino, Korean, Thai, South Asian, and Indigenous undocumented residents. A list of those organizations may be found at https://www.immigrantfundca.org/los-angeles.


Thank you for ensuring that the City of Santa Monica communicates proactively and frequently with all its residents during this time of physical and economic danger. Please call on Santa Monica Forward to assist you if we can be helpful.
